Verhindern, dass Server von Codierung in gzip, wenn sie mit WebClient Download
Frage
Ich habe einen Download-Manager von Sorten, die WebClient.DownloadFileAsync verwendet. Webclient scheint nicht gzip-Codierung und einige Server beharren auf Verwendung zu behandeln. Da fast alle Dateien werden diese bereits komprimiert herunterzuladen, wäre es schön, nur in der Lage sein, sie zu zwingen, zu stoppen.
Ich habe versucht, das zu nichts Accept-Encoding Einstellung aber Servern halten noch gzip senden. Ist es möglich, zu deaktivieren oder muss ich auf die Überprüfung response greifen?
Lösung
Sehen Sie diesen Jeff Atwood Beitrag für die Lösung:
http://www.codinghorror.com/blog /2004/08/netwebclient-and-gzip.html
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ow